My Beginnings with EHCB


In 2020, I started the eight-month EHCB program without really knowing what to expect. After many years participating in federation courses, clinics, private programs, and international events, I thought I had already seen it all. However, this experience exceeded every expectation I had.


From the very first moment, the impact was remarkable. The program combines top-level online theoretical training, taught by professors from the University of Belgrade, covering every aspect of basketball — technical, tactical, psychological, and physical — and complemented by exclusive talks with EuroLeague coaches.


Learning from the Best


ree

The theoretical part alone was already of the highest standard, but listening each week to some of the brightest minds in basketball was something truly exceptional. I had the privilege of learning from Zeljko Obradovic, Dimitris Itoudis, Pablo Laso, Xavi Pascual, Sergio Scariolo, Chus Mateo, Sarunas Jasikevicius, Ettore Messina, Giannis Sfairopoulos, among many others.

Being able to listen, learn, and even interact with them over several months was a deeply enriching and inspiring experience, far beyond what I could have imagined.

The Ambassador Program


From the very beginning, I also joined the “Ambassador” program, which allows former participants to return for future generations, attend the congress again, and take part in sessions as if they were students once more.

Five generations later, the program continues to innovate and raise its standards. Over the years, it has expanded to include university professors, EuroLeague and EuroCup coaches, assistant coaches, referees, strength and conditioning coaches, and even hands-on experiences with EuroLeague, EuroCup, NBA teams, and U.S. academies, enriching both the online and in-person components.

A Unique Opportunity


ree

In the summer of 2024, as I was preparing to attend the third congress in Glyfada (Greece), I received a professional opportunity I could have never imagined.

I was selected by the organization for an interview with Coach Sergio Scariolo, head coach of the Spanish National Team, with the goal of joining his staff and learning firsthand about the preparation process for a FIBA Olympic Qualifying Tournament.


For 40 days, I was part of the coaching staff, contributing on the court and assisting with scouting of the participating teams. After Spain secured its qualification for the Paris 2024 Olympic Games, I had the honor of continuing with the team during their pre-Olympic training stage. (Photos)
